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What are the main advantages of choosing custom leather-look silicone keychains over genuine leather?

Custom leather-look silicone keychains offer a superior blend of durability and ethics. They are completely vegan, highly water-resistant and easy to clean, and far more durable against daily wear and tear. Unlike genuine leather, they won’t crack, peel, or fade quickly, and they offer greater flexibility for intricate designs and vibrant colors through modern printing techniques.

What are the best design practices for a professional-looking leather-look silicone keychain?

To achieve a professional look, focus on:
Leveraging Texture: Use design elements that mimic genuine leather grains and stitching.
Strategic Color Use: Opt for rich, deep tones like burgundy, navy, brown, or black to enhance the leather-like appearance.
Simplicity and Clarity: Ensure your logo and text are clear, legible, and not overly complex to ensure a clean imprint.
High-Resolution Artwork: Always provide vector files (AI, EPS) or high-resolution PNGs to guarantee a crisp, sharp final product.

How durable are leather-look silicone keychains for everyday use?

Extremely durable. Silicone is renowned for its flexibility, tear-resistance, and ability to withstand extreme temperatures. These keychains are built for daily use, resisting scratches, moisture, and UV exposure far better than many other materials, ensuring your branded promotional product remains intact and professional-looking for a long time.

Can you achieve a realistic leather texture on silicone?

Absolutely. Advanced molding and printing technologies allow manufacturers to emboss a highly realistic leather texture directly onto the silicone material. This process creates a tactile surface that looks and feels remarkably similar to genuine leather, providing an elevated, luxury aesthetic without using animal products.

What printing methods are used for custom leather-look silicone keychains?

The two most common and effective methods are:
Screen Printing: Ideal for solid, opaque colors and simpler designs. It offers excellent durability and color vibrancy.
Digital Printing (or UV Printing): Best for highly detailed, multi-colored, or photographic designs. It allows for full-color printing directly onto the silicone surface with precision.

What is the typical turnaround time for an order of custom keychains?

The production time can vary depending on the complexity of the design and the order quantity, but it typically ranges from 10 to 15 business days after final design approval. This includes time for mold creation (if needed), printing, quality control, and shipping. Always confirm timelines with your manufacturer.

How do I care for my leather-look silicone keychain to ensure it lasts?

Caring for your keychain is simple due to the resilient nature of silicone material. Just wipe it clean with a damp cloth and mild soap if it gets dirty.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as these could potentially damage the printed design over time. Their innate water-resistant qualities make them very low-maintenance.
